Output 85f354c4890c859313c26685615582edf2899c4268ca800c17ad066d7ed619ed:5

value
24579739
script pubkey
OP_0 OP_PUSHBYTES_20 cdb6d12640252382c2a271e51fa571be7421863c
address
ltc1qekmdzfjqy53c9s4zw8j3lft3he6zrp3uecsmd3
transaction
85f354c4890c859313c26685615582edf2899c4268ca800c17ad066d7ed619ed
spent
true